In 2016, Canada legalized medical assistance in dying (MAID) for adults with a severe and irreversible illness, disease or disability. Social media posts sharing photos of a pamphlet referring to MAID for "mature minors" claimed it promoted MAID to children or that MAID is currently, or soon will be, available to children, including those experiencing mental illness. These claims are false. The pamphlet actually advocates against MAID access for minors.
